For starters, SUNSHARE kits come pre-configured with microinverters that are already paired to the solar panels. This eliminates the need for manual configuration or on-site calibration, which is typically a time-consuming step in traditional setups. Each panel operates independently, thanks to module-level power electronics (MLPE), meaning installers don’t have to worry about string sizing or voltage balancing. The wiring uses standardized connectors—think “click-and-go” interfaces—that are weatherproof and color-coded to prevent mismatches. Even the mounting hardware is designed for universal compatibility, with adjustable brackets that fit most roof types, from clay tiles to metal seams.

Safety is another cornerstone of SUNSHARE’s plug-and-play approach. The system includes built-in rapid shutdown functionality, compliant with IEC 62109 and NEC 2017 standards, which automatically cuts power during maintenance or emergencies. This feature not only protects installers but also streamlines inspections, as inspectors can verify compliance without disassembling components. For grid connectivity, the inverters are pre-certified for major European grid codes, including VDE-AR-N 4105 in Germany, ensuring seamless integration with local utilities.

The companion app, accessible via iOS or Android, provides real-time diagnostics and step-by-step visual guides during installation. For example, if a panel isn’t generating power, the app pinpoints the exact location on a 3D roof map and suggests troubleshooting steps—like checking connector seals or panel alignment. This reduces dependency on technical support and empowers users to resolve issues independently. Post-installation, the system continuously monitors performance, alerting users to shading issues or debris accumulation through predictive analytics.
